1. Neutral Color Scheme

The first color combination on our list is the neutral color scheme. This is a classic choice for small living rooms as it creates a clean and timeless look. Neutral colors such as white, beige, and gray can make a space feel more open and airy. They also provide a great backdrop for pops of color through accessories and furniture.

Using a neutral color scheme in a small living room also allows for more flexibility in terms of decor. You can easily switch out accent pieces and change up the style without having to worry about clashing colors. This makes it a great option for those who like to switch up their decor frequently.

2. Monochromatic Color Palette

A monochromatic color palette involves using different shades and tints of a single color. This can create a cohesive and calming look in a small living room. For example, you can use different shades of blue, from light to dark, to create a serene and relaxing atmosphere.

This color combination works well for small living rooms as it avoids any harsh contrasts and keeps the space feeling unified. It also allows you to play around with different textures and patterns within the same color family to add interest to the room.

3. Light and Bright Color Combination

If you want to make your small living room feel more spacious and inviting, consider using a light and bright color combination. This can include colors such as light blue, pale yellow, or soft pink. These colors reflect natural light and can make a room feel larger and more open.

Pairing these light colors with white or off-white accents can also create a fresh and airy look. This color combination is perfect for small living rooms that lack natural light, as it can help brighten up the space.

5. Contrasting Color Scheme

If you want to add some drama and visual interest to your small living room, consider using a contrasting color scheme. This involves pairing two colors that are opposite each other on the color wheel, such as blue and orange or purple and yellow.

This color combination can create a bold and dynamic look in a small space. Just be sure to balance out the contrasting colors with neutral accents to avoid overwhelming the room.

How to Create a Welcoming Atmosphere in a Small Living Room

Color Combination For Small Living Room

Utilize Light and Neutral Colors

Color Combination For Small Living Room When it comes to designing a small living room, color combination is crucial. Choosing the right colors can make a small space feel bigger and more inviting. The key is to stick to light and neutral colors, such as white, beige, and light grey. These shades reflect light and create an open and airy feel in the room. Avoid using dark colors, as they can make the space feel smaller and more cramped.

Don't Forget About Lighting

Color Combination For Small Living Room Lighting plays a significant role in creating the right atmosphere in a small living room. Natural light is the best option, so avoid heavy curtains and opt for sheer or light-colored drapes. If natural light is limited, incorporate light fixtures strategically throughout the room. Use a mix of overhead lighting, floor lamps, and table lamps to create layers of light and make the space feel larger.
